Frequently Asked Questions

What is the Repit School Score for Jefferson West Middle?
Jefferson West Middle has a Repit School Score of 79 out of 100, earning a grade of B+. This score evaluates class size (student-teacher ratio), funding levels, and resources rather than just test scores.
How many students attend Jefferson West Middle?
Jefferson West Middle has 266 students enrolled for the 2024-25 school year. The student-to-teacher ratio is 15.3:1.
What grades does Jefferson West Middle serve?
Jefferson West Middle serves grades 05 – 08 and is classified as a School. This is a public school.
How much funding does Jefferson West Middle receive per student?
Jefferson West Middle receives $15,676 in per-pupil spending from its district. This is above the national average.

About Repit School Scores

Traditional school ratings rely heavily on standardized test scores, which often reflect family income more than actual school quality. Repit takes a different approach.

We evaluate schools based on factors that research shows actually impact educational outcomes:

  • Class Size — Smaller classes mean more individual attention and better student outcomes.
  • School Funding — Resources available for programs, teachers, and facilities directly affect education quality.
  • School Environment — School size and structure affect available programs and student experience.
